Comparative Preservation Characteristics

The comparison between traditional bullion and decentralized ledgers extends beyond scarcity. Gold exhibits stable purchasing power over centuries but incurs storage and liquidity costs. Conversely, network-native tokens offer frictionless transferability and divisibility, with custodial solutions evolving rapidly to ensure security without physical overhead. For example:

  • Gold requires secure vaults and insurance fees averaging 0.5%-1% annually.
  • Cryptographic assets can be stored cold or via multisignature wallets with nominal maintenance expenses.

This operational efficiency affects total cost of ownership when preserving wealth during periods of currency depreciation.

Volatility remains a critical factor differentiating these classes. While bullion prices fluctuate based on geopolitical tensions and supply-demand imbalances, ledger-based tokens have historically shown higher price swings linked to market sentiment and regulatory developments. However, long-term holding strategies demonstrate gradual appreciation correlating with adoption metrics and network security enhancements–attributes absent in conventional commodities.

A notable case study involves Venezuela’s hyperinflation crisis from 2017-2020 where citizens turned increasingly toward scarce cryptographic assets for remittance preservation compared to gold reserves limited by accessibility issues. This real-world application underscores how programmable scarcity combined with borderless transfer capabilities enhances utility as a store of worth under extreme economic stress.

Volatility Patterns and Market Drivers

The comparative stability between these two classes is influenced heavily by liquidity depth and market maturity. Bullion markets benefit from extensive infrastructure including futures exchanges, ETFs, and sovereign holdings that dampen abrupt value shifts. In contrast, digital tokens operate on nascent platforms where liquidity fragmentation across multiple venues can exacerbate price swings. For instance, during March 2020’s global selloff triggered by pandemic fears, bullion prices briefly dipped but recovered swiftly; meanwhile, token valuations plummeted over 50%, illustrating differing resilience under systemic stress.

Preservation of purchasing power also depends on macroeconomic contexts. Inflation erodes fiat currency utility; therefore assets that maintain or grow real worth gain investor preference. Historical records indicate that bullion preserves wealth effectively during stagflation episodes–such as the 1970s–while cryptocurrency’s track record remains shorter but promising amid recent inflationary spikes post-2020 stimulus measures. Nevertheless, one must consider that policy uncertainties and adoption hurdles still inject considerable risk into token-based assets’ stability profiles.

Regulatory Risks for Digital Assets

Strict regulatory measures remain the most significant threat to the preservation of value in alternative monetary instruments designed as a hedge against inflation. Jurisdictions introducing abrupt bans or stringent compliance requirements create liquidity constraints that can lead to sharp price corrections and reduced market participation. For instance, the 2021 crackdown in China resulted in a drastic decline in mining activity and trading volumes, demonstrating how policy shifts directly influence asset stability and investor confidence.

The challenge lies in balancing innovation with consumer protection. Regulatory bodies often struggle to classify these instruments due to their hybrid nature–neither traditional securities nor commodities like precious metals. The U.S. Securities and Exchange Commission’s (SEC) ongoing scrutiny of tokenized assets exemplifies this ambiguity, where enforcement actions have caused notable volatility. Such uncertainty complicates long-term strategic planning for holders seeking reliable value retention mechanisms akin to physical stores of wealth.

Key Regulatory Issues Impacting Asset Integrity

Among pressing concerns are anti-money laundering (AML) directives, know-your-customer (KYC) mandates, and taxation frameworks that vary widely across countries. These rules affect transaction transparency and accessibility, potentially discouraging smaller investors from participating or holding positions over extended periods. As a case study, the European Union’s Markets in Crypto-Assets Regulation (MiCA) aims to standardize rules but introduces compliance costs that might disproportionately impact emerging projects and user adoption.
